Some environmentally friendly alternatives to plastic trash bags include biodegradable trash bags made from plant-based materials such as corn or potato starch, compostable trash bags made from materials like paper or certified compostable plastics, and reusable cloth bags or bins for collecting and disposing of waste.

How can I dispose of my old stationary bike in an environmentally friendly way?

To dispose of your old stationary bike in an environmentally friendly way, consider donating it to a local charity or community organization, selling it to someone who can use it, or recycling it at a facility that accepts metal and electronic waste. Avoid throwing it in the trash, as this can harm the environment.

How can I dispose of large mirrors in an environmentally friendly way?

To dispose of large mirrors in an environmentally friendly way, you can consider donating them to a local charity or thrift store, selling them online or through a garage sale, or contacting a glass recycling facility to see if they accept mirrors. It is important to avoid throwing mirrors in the regular trash as they can be hazardous and not biodegradable.

How can I recycle 5 microwave-safe containers in an environmentally friendly way?

To recycle 5 microwave-safe containers in an environmentally friendly way, rinse them clean, check if they are accepted by your local recycling program, and place them in the appropriate recycling bin. If not accepted, consider reusing them for storage or donating to a local organization. Avoid throwing them in the trash to reduce waste and help protect the environment.

What are the best ways to dispose of used kitty litter sand in an environmentally friendly manner?

To dispose of used kitty litter sand in an environmentally friendly manner, consider using biodegradable or compostable litter options. You can also scoop waste into biodegradable bags and dispose of it in the trash or bury it in your yard away from water sources. Avoid flushing litter down the toilet as it can harm aquatic ecosystems.
